For many, indoor storage is the gold standard, especially given our winter weather. A climate-controlled unit protects your boat from freezing temperatures, which can crack engine blocks and damage hulls, and from summer humidity that promotes mold and mildew. Look for facilities in the Lecontes Mills or nearby Curwensville area that offer secure, dry storage with 24/7 access. This is ideal for larger vessels or for owners who want absolute peace of mind. If a fully enclosed unit isn't in the budget, consider a covered storage option. These carport-style spaces shield your boat from sun, rain, hail, and snow load, which is a significant advantage during our Pennsylvania winters.
Outdoor storage is often the most economical and accessible choice. When evaluating lots, prioritize security features like gated access, fencing, and good lighting. Since Lecontes Mills experiences a fair amount of precipitation, ensure you have a quality, well-fitted cover that is weatherproof and breathable. Before storing outdoors anywhere in PA, remember to winterize your boat thoroughly by fogging the engine, stabilizing the fuel, and removing the battery to prevent cold-weather damage.
Don't overlook marina storage, particularly if you frequent the Susquehanna. Several marinas within a short drive offer seasonal in-water or dry stack storage. This option provides incredible convenience for spontaneous summer outings. Be sure to inquire about their haul-out schedules in the fall to align with your winter plans. A key local tip is to plan well ahead. The demand for prime storage, especially indoor, peaks in late fall. Start calling facilities by early October to secure your spot.
